geow2 wrote:

Plus, I think I was over charged ...my store credits went from $75 to $39.89 just for two albums!

My understanding of the US retail system (assuming that is where you are located) is that the price does not include sales tax, which is added to the total cost of the two albums. So without more detail of the price of the albums and the local sales tax in your state, there is no way for anyone here to comment on that (other than my observation).


If you think that your claim is valid, you're more likely to get back any overpayment by taking the issue up with store.
